Please enable JavaScript.
Coggle requires JavaScript to display documents.
DATA BASE, IMG_20210925_110719 - Coggle Diagram
DATA BASE
DEFINIZIONE
attraverso i database è possibile memorizzare e gestire in modo flessibile ed efficiente le informazioni che sono il "vero patrimonio di ogni organizzazione"
e dove poter fare:
-ricercare e recuperare;
-selezionarle;
-aggiungerne;
-modificarle;
-cancellare;
possono essere considerati una raccolta di dati progettati in modo tale da poter essere utilizzati in maniera ottimizzata da differenti applicazioni e da utenti diversi
TEORIA
DELLE BASI DI DATI
-
-
EFFICIENTE
l'utilizzo delle risorse deve essere ottimizzato rispetto al tempo e allo spazio:
-efficiente utilizzo del processore;
-efficiente utilizzo della memoria;
SOLIDO
deve resistere a malfunzionamenti ed errori, come guasti al computer o alla rete
-
-
-
ARCHIVIO
-
APPLICAZIONE INFORMATICA
utilizza dati in esso immagazzinati per compiere una funzione specifica all'interno dell'organizzazione cui il SI appartiene
PROBLEMATICHE
ISOLAMENTO
le varie applicazioni risultano essere isolate le une dalle altre anche se fanno parte dello stesso sistema
-
INCONGRUENZA
se un dato di un articolo viene modificato, tale modifica dovrà essere apportata a tutti i record che hanno quell'articolo
-
DIPENDENZA LOGICA
l'impossibilità di modificare la struttura di un record, senza generare a cascata un insieme di modifiche in tutti i programmi che utilizzano quel file
DIPENDENZA FISICA
scarsa flessibilità e le nuove esigenze, potrebbero essere irrealizzabili a causa della struttura degli archivi
-
-